11. The following are continuation grants that have been awarded to Prescott Unified School District – submitted by Marianne Brooks.

 

Title I Part A ( Improving Basic Programs Operated by Local Education Agencies)

2005-2006 Allocation: $715,701.00

2006-2007 Allocation: $745,917.00

To provide compensatory education services to educationally disadvantaged preschool, elementary and secondary school children (including private school pupils) in low-income areas in meeting the Arizona Academic Standards. Please refer to Enclosure #6.

 

Title II – A (Improving Teacher Quality)

2005-2006 Allocation: $179,660.00

2006-2007 Allocation: $180,656.00

The purpose of Title II-A, Improving Teacher Quality, is to increase the academic achievement of all students by helping schools and LEAs improve teacher and principal quality and ensure that all teachers are highly qualified. Please refer to Enclosure #7.

 

Title V – A (Innovative Programs) Formerly Title VI

2005-2006 Allocation: $17,297.00

2006-2007 Allocation: $ 8,673.00

To improve elementary and secondary education by providing formula grants to states to support a broad range of state and local school improvement programs. Please refer to Enclosure #8.

 

Title IV (Safe and Drug Free Schools and Communities)

2005-2006 Allocation: $27,238.53

2006-2007 Allocation: $20,289.00

To support comprehensive school and community-based programs designed to make the nation’s schools safe and free of drugs in order that the climate is conducive to the achievement of high standards for all students. Please refer to Enclosure #9.
